Asbestos roof removal regulations and guidelines are crucial for protecting public health and ensuring safe practices throughout demolition and renovation initiatives. Asbestos, a as soon as generally used material that's now recognized to be a potent health hazard, poses vital dangers when disturbed. When dealing with or eradicating asbestos, particular regulations should be adhered to in order to reduce exposure to airborne fibers.


Regulatory authorities have established detailed guidelines that define the processes necessary for protected asbestos removal. These regulations typically require training for workers, correct gear, and waste disposal strategies. Understanding these guidelines is important for homeowners, contractors, and facility managers to keep away from authorized repercussions and guarantee security.

In many jurisdictions, solely licensed professionals are permitted to deal with asbestos removal. These educated individuals possess the information and instruments required to safely manage the dangers related to asbestos. Licensing necessities typically embody coursework, hands-on coaching, and certification exams, making certain that solely certified personnel perform the removal.


Before any removal project begins, an assessment must take place. This evaluation sometimes involves an inspection of the area, sampling of the fabric, and lab evaluation to confirm the presence of asbestos. Conducting an intensive survey ensures that stakeholders perceive the scope of the project and the material's situation earlier than any work commences.

Regulations might mandate a comprehensive threat evaluation to judge potential publicity. This assessment delves into each the existing situation of the asbestos and any potential disturbances. If the material is in good situation, regulatory our bodies would possibly advocate leaving it undisturbed somewhat than present process removal.


Proper containment is one other important component of asbestos removal. Work areas should typically be sealed to forestall the release of fibers into the encircling surroundings. This process can embody using plastic sheeting and specialised airflow systems to handle and include any potential publicity during the removal course of.

Personal protecting gear (PPE) is important for all workers involved in asbestos removal. Regulations usually mandate respirators, disposable coveralls, gloves, and eye safety. Adhering to these necessities significantly reduces the chance of inhalation or pores and skin contact with hazardous materials during the removal process.


Once the asbestos has been eliminated, proper waste disposal turns into paramount. Regulations normally dictate that asbestos waste should be double-bagged and clearly labeled to tell handlers of the potential hazards. Safe transport and disposal at designated amenities can mitigate dangers, allowing for responsible management of asbestos waste.


Documentation is an ignored but essential facet of compliance with asbestos roof removal regulations and guidelines. Detailed records of assessments, removal procedures, and waste disposal have to be maintained. This documentation serves as proof of adherence to regulations and provides priceless info for future inspections or inquiries.


Failing to comply with asbestos removal regulations can lead to severe penalties. Violators may face hefty fines, legal motion, and significant liability associated to health impacts on employees and close by individuals. Emphasizing compliance not solely safeguards health but additionally protects against authorized repercussions.

How can I inform if my roof contains asbestos?undefinedAsbestos was commonly used in roofing materials till the late Eighties. If your roof is made of materials like shingles, tar paper, or coatings from that era, lab testing by a licensed skilled is critical to verify asbestos presence.

How is asbestos roof waste disposed of?undefinedAsbestos waste must be double-bagged in particular baggage labeled for hazardous materials and disposed of at licensed landfills that accept asbestos. Local regulations often outline the disposal process, and adherence is crucial for safety.


Is it secure to remove an asbestos roof on my own?undefinedRemoving an asbestos roof without skilled assist is not advisable because of the health risks related to asbestos exposure. Professionals are trained in protected removal strategies and disposal practices that decrease threat.
